In this new podcast, Dr. Jordan describes the costs to kids from experiencing a decrease in free play and time outdoors. He also discusses the many benefits of kids experiencing: self-directed play, chances to handle their own conflicts and problems, play with some degree of physical risk, and having the freedom to choose and direct their activities and do them for their own sake vs. for trophies and applause.Previous related podcasts of Dr. Jordan:Girls Need To Experience More Risk & Adv...

In this new podcast, Dr. Jordan interviews Nic McKinley, an expert in the prevention of child trafficking, about what parents and the government can do to prevent their children from becoming prey to online predators.
